The new reporter spec generalizes key-value options that can be passed to the reporter, looking like this `reporterName[::key=value]*`. A key can be either Catch2-recognized, which currently means either `out` or `colour`, or reporter-specific which is anything prefixed with `X`, e.g. `Xfoo`.
